It wasn't improved at all. With the low contrast graphics and the no-feedback from crew and ship I find this very hard to play. In FTL if you hear heartbeats or a blaring alarm you know something requires your attention. When a room turns red, you see it even if you are not paying attention. In this game, if you are fixated on combat and the enemy shields, you will most likely not notice that a room is slowly turning from dark grey to the same dark grey with a slight shade of pink.

I bought it, played it some, and asked for a refund. This game is not ready at all and needs a lot of love. There is zero feedback from the ship or the crew. No blaring alarm when your ship is on fire or has a leak, or when your hull integrity gets low. The crew will happily suffocate in silence, if your captain happens to die in silence, its game over. Etc... etc... etc. I can see it has potential, but in its current state it is not even close to FTL. Hopefully it will improve quickly, but I will wait a year or two before I revisit it.
